Egypt has not been involved in combat against the Taliban, and they've only taken very limited steps to squelch weapons supplies flowing into the Palestinian territories, despite Mubarrak being 'pro-Israel'. Also, the United States does not import oil from Egypt, and despite popular opinion, imports very little oil from the Middle East. Canada and Mexico are our two largest suppliers. The primary threat to the oil supply is any condition which would shut down the Suez Canal. Simply the THREAT of such an event is driving up oil prices.

As for our need for allies, I certainly agree. However, the United States is a country that stands for freedom and justice, and our propping up of corrupt and tyrannical regimes in the interest of 'security' has caused too many problems already. It makes us hypocrites to the people of the Middle East, and we've already seen it backfire with Iraq. Free democracies make better, more stable allies in any case.

@Benjaminvallen1
-but there are NO "Free democracies" in the middle east,other then israel, to work with. And faced with the choice of support no one,or support those who will be the least destructive,if you want to be involved you have to choose the latter.

As for the muslim brotherhood,their youth organization (brotherhood youth)(Shabab Elikhwan) helped organize (for months beforehand) the protests and has been out there in the square since day one.The protests probably wouldnt have even happened had it not been for the brotherhood youth.And thats only taking into account the visible contributions they made,dont forget they are an "outlawed" organization, and often stay in the shadows and hide among other orgs while doing their "work".

The muslim brotherhood is the largest opposition group,and again, thats with many of them pretending not to be part of it.And democracy is not in their plans....no matter what they try to pass off as their "new attitude".
